Laird’s Apple Brandy barrel

One delicate Belgian blonde spend the perfect amount of time in ten different and carefully selected barrels. This is the first beer project done by The Aviary. Teamed with Evil Twin Brewing of Denmark, this beer is a qualified experiment to show how a subtle beer take flavour from the barrels of the best, rarest spirits found anywhere. Enjoy this one and look forward to ten amazing more.

Bottle shared with the below two jokers at Torst. First i’d like to note that i dig the labeling, especially with the gimmick of increasing birds. Pours golden orange with nice strong apple brandy nose. Tastes of caramel, earth, ginger, yeast, light smoke, and very appley. there is some alcohol warming on finish. quite enjoyable.

Bottle at Torst. Pours amber. Nose and taste of apple brandy, toffee, caramel malt, dried fruit and bready malt. Great balance. Medium body. The barrel aging really imparts a lot of character on the lighter beer, but in a very pleasant way. Great experiment. Looking forward to the rest of the series.
